Neve Campbell looked radiant as ever as she went out for dinner at Giorgio Baldi in Santa Monica, California on Wednesday.

The actress, 50, showed off her youthful looks on the night out and cut a stylish figure in a dark printed blouse with a pair of navy jeans.

The film star also wore a white blazer and added to her outfit with beige sandals and a matching handbag. 

Wearing her brunette locks in a loose bob, Neve completed her look with a silver necklace and matching earrings.

The actress will be back on screens soon as she has signed up to star in the seventh instalment of the Scream franchise.

Neve, who plays Sidney Prescott in the films, declined to appear in the sixth movie released in 2023 over a pay dispute. 

The star said the salary she was offered did not equate to the ‘value’ she has brought to the franchise, which began in 1996. 

In an interview with People, she said: ‘I did not feel that what I was being offered equated to the value that I bring to this franchise, and have brought to this franchise, for 25 years.

‘And as a woman in this business, I think it’s really important for us to be valued and to fight to be valued.’ 

However, Neve has signed on to return for the seventh film which will be directed by Kevin Williamson who wrote the screenplays for Scream, Scream 2 and Scream 4.    

For the upcoming film, Neve told the outlet that negotiations were different.

‘I’m really grateful that the studio heard me when I talked about pay discrepancy and when I talked about [Scream VI negotiations] not feeling respectful,’ she said.

‘When they first approached me [for Scream 7], I thought, ‘I don’t know what respectful looks like to them. We might be in very different places.’

‘But they started out in a strong place, so that was lovely,’ she recalled. 

‘It feels nice to have put that out into the world and to have been listened to and to have made a difference in that way,’ she added. 

‘I hope other people get that opportunity too.’
